Pantai Cenang

Pantai Cenang is a short hop from our base at the Royal Langkawi Yacht Club and a great stop prior to returning back to base.  It is located on the most south western tip of the island and is about 11.5 miles from Kuah Town.  It features fine sands, crystal clear waters, elegant casuarinas and lofty coconut trees that line the 1.5 mile stretch of beachfront.  While it is the most popular area of Langkawi it still has great charm and an air of serenity and tranquility.  It is a place to chill out and enjoy the picturesque vista along the shore.   

The coastline is dotted with innumerable restaurants, bars and nightclubs.  Try the Red Tomato for a drink or Orkid Ria and sample some of their finest giant tiger prawns.  Dining out on your yacht charter to Pantai Cenang can be a sense-assaulting experience, one where you can choose between the simplicity of the hawker stalls, the din of noisy kopitimians or the elegant ambiance of international restaurants.  There is infinite shopping  to stock up on the essential souvenirs, thrilling water sports, scintillating nightlife for those with more energy to burn, and amazingly delicious seafood.  

A Langkawi yacht charter would not be the same if you were to miss the spectacular sunset, but be sure to have a cold drink in hand to fully appreciate the wonderful site.  Beyond the sands are the lush green rainforests, which provide a grand treat for those with an adventurous nerve.  
 

 

Mooring:

  • Anchor off Pentai Tengah in 3.5 metres.

Things to do:

  • Visit the Rice Garden Museam
  • Go to Underwater World – Malaysia’s largest aquarium
  • Sit in a beach bar and watch the world go by.
  • Enjoy the sunset.
  • Shop until you drop.

Facilities:

  • Bank
  • Provisions
  • Bars and Restaurants
